The BBC Garden website has good advice on growing snowdrops. If we had read it earlier, we would long ago have stopped buying dry snowdrop bulbs and planting them in the lawn. The ones I sent Judith and Pam are 'in the green'. Until you mentioned it recently, we didn't know you could buy them in the green. The dry bulbs that were planted under trees last autumn have done well, all are in flower. If you get really fresh bulbs, you're fine. It's those desiccated things in little packets that have been hanging around for ages that are such a disappointment. Mind you, I'm still gasping at what some people are charging for them 'in the green'. I saw something like 20 for £12 advertised the other day! -- Sacha http://www.hillhousenursery.com South Devon Exotic plants, shrubs & perennials online |
